Instructions:
- In a sa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Whisk in the flour to form a light brown roux, stirring continuously for 5–7 minutes.
- Add the chopped onion, bell pepper, and celery. Cook until the vegetables are soft and fragrant.
- Stir in the garlic and cook for 1 more minute.
- Slowly pour in the seafood stock (or water), whisking until smooth and slightly thickened.
- Add the shrimp and Cajun seasoning. Let simmer for 5–7 minutes, or until the shrimp are pink and cooked through.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ste. Stir in the chopped parsley.
- Serve hot over a bed of fluffy white rice.
